Graduation Countdown Flower Pot
The idea behind it is that once a day, her niece will pick one of the flowers from the pot and read the little message inside written by her mother or other family members.
We told her mom, who is struggling with the idea of her daughter graduating, to try to keep the messages positive.
No "I will be lost without yous" and definitely no "Please stay a little longers." After she picks all the flowers her graduation will be the following day and then she will get to read the graduation letter that looks like the rolled diploma.
I used the Everyday Paper Doll cricut cartridge for the caps and the Disney friends cart for the pawprints. Each card is a 2x4 strip folded in half. They all have a slit in them to slide the cards on and off the sticks.

Made by Me Monday: first grade bulletin board idea

I am skippin' along with Lou today and posting some items I have cut for one of the first grade teachers in our building.
These sweet little cows are from the create a critter cartridge for the cricut and they are cut at 4 inches. The barns are cut at 4 1/2 inches and the grass strip is 1 1/4 inch by 8 1/2 inches.
The words, which are not pictured, are also at 4 inches and say "First Grade is Something To Moooooooo about."

Hump Day Craft Post: oh crap!
I was playing around with the Cricut Campin' Critters cartridge and just because this port-a-potty skunk made me chuckle I thought I'd cut it out. In my warped mind it would make a clever invitation. You could put a little "Oh Crap" sign on the potty door and on the back you could write "Summer's almost over. Join us for a picnic on ......". You get the picture.
The only thing I don't like about this cartridge is the eyes. I recommend having some googly eyes lying around because the eye cuts from the cart don't look realistic.
